phpstudy中的数据库怎么和vsc链接
时间: 2024-12-24 15:32:21 浏览: 64
在PHPStudy中配置数据库连接到Visual Studio Code (VSC)通常涉及几个步骤:
1. **安装驱动**:首先,确保您已经安装了对应于您的MySQL版本的PHP扩展,比如php_mysql或php_pdo_mysql。这是通过PHPStudy的控制面板进行设置的。
2. **创建数据库连接**:在VSC中,您可以选择使用像`php artisan db:seed`这样的命令行工具(对于Laravel框架),或者直接在代码中编写如下的PDO或mysqli连接代码:
```php
// PDO示例
$host = 'localhost';
$dbname = 'your_database_name';
$username = 'your_username';
$password = 'your_password';
try {
$pdo = new PDO("mysql:host=$host;dbname=$dbname", $username, $password);
$pdo->set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ION);
} catch(PDOException $e) {
echo "Connection failed: " . $e->getMessage();
}
```
3. **设置环境变量**:将数据库信息保存在一个安全的地方,可以在VSC的用户代码目录下创建一个`.env`文件,或者使用项目级别的配置文件(如果有的话)。这将帮助你在代码中引用数据库连接而不暴露敏感信息。
4. **配置数据库扩展**:在VSC中启用相应的PHP插件(如php-debug、php-intellisense等),它们可能会自动检测并管理数据库连接。
5. **启动服务器**:运行PHPStudy中的Apache或Nginx服务,并确保代码中的连接尝试在本地环境中可以成功访问。
6. **测试连接**:在VSC内打开一个PHP文件,尝试连接并执行查询,看看是否能正常工作。
阅读全文
相关推荐


















